Serial Prankster Daniel Jarvis Arrested After Lining Up With Kangaroos Before Ashes Test

The 37-year-old Englishman has a long record of high-profile breaches at major events.

  • Police in Liverpool detained Daniel Jarvis on suspicion of possession of articles for use in fraud and fraud by false representation after he entered the pitch before kick-off.
  • Jarvis stood beside Cameron Munster during the Australian anthem at Hill Dickinson Stadium wearing a replica Kangaroos jersey marked “Jarvo 69.”
  • Cameron Munster said he initially thought the man had a corporate arrangement and later described the moment as “pretty funny” after realizing who it was.
  • Security escorted Jarvis from the field during the anthems, with witnesses describing the intervention as aggressive.
  • Jarvis was previously convicted of aggravated trespass after a 2022 incident at The Oval and has staged other stunts including at the Paris Olympics and during BBC football coverage, with a reported inquiry after he claimed a House of Commons prank.
